SEMA BATTLE OF THE BUILDERS PRESENTED BY MOTHERS Location: Central Hall, Booth #24743
SEMA Show vehicle builders will once again take center stage in the annual SEMA Battle of the Builders (BOTB) Presented by Mothers Polish. This unique competition helps attendees, and millions following the action online, to spot trends and see the latest techniques of some of the world’s most influential builders. Introduced in 2014 to recognize and celebrate proven vehicle builders and products across all market categories.
While expert judges narrow the selection down, it’s the builders themselves who ultimately cast the votes to select the overall winner. You can follow the progress at the BOTB stage introducing the top 40 finalists at 1:30 pm, Tuesday, November 3, and another announcing the top 12 at 3:00 pm, Wednesday, November 4. The Top 4 finalists will be announced on Thursday, November 5, at 3:30 pm, and the final winner will be announced Friday, November 6, at 3:30 pm as one of the culminating highlights of the SEMA Show. The Las Vegas Convention Center also offers fast, convenient, free on-campus transportation!
Vegas Loop at the Las Vegas Convention Center quickly transports passengers throughout the 200-acre Las Vegas Convention Center campus in a fun and convenient way, free of charge. The system consists of two one-way, .8-mile-long tunnels built to accommodate all-electric Tesla vehicles driving at speeds of up to 35 mph. Four passenger stations offer convenient access between the new West Hall and the existing campus (North/Central/South Halls). Typical walk time between the West Hall to the existing North/Central Hall can take up to 25 minutes. The same trip on LVCC Loop takes approximately 2 minutes
Attendees can access Vegas Loop at Las Vegas Convention Center via four stations:
South Station – Adjacent to South Hall, this station is located above ground
Central Station – Near the Central Hall Main Entrance, this station is located belowground and is accessible via escalator or elevator
West Station – Adjacent to West Hall, this station is located above ground
Riviera Station – At the North side of the West Hall closest to Elvis Presley Drive, with direct access to Resorts World. This station is located above ground.
The Vegas Loop has officially opened the Resorts World Passenger Station, providing direct access to and from the Las Vegas Convention Center. Riders can now access the Resorts World station from any of the Convention Center stations (South Station, Central station, West Station and Riviera Station).
There is no charge to travel between stations at the Las Vegas Convention Center. A valid Vegas Loop Ticket will be required for any rides arriving from or departing to any station outside of the Convention Center Campus.

SHOW APP
SHOW APP
The 2024 SEMA Show Mobile App will be available in the Fall.
Mobile app features include:
Interactivity:Users can receive detailed information about feature vehicles displayed throughout the Las Vegas Convention Center. By simply scanning a vehicle's QR code, located on a feature vehicle sticker attached to the vehicle during check-in, the app will display the vehicle's year, make and model; information on the exhibitor displaying the vehicle; and a list of products used on the vehicle.
Turn-By-Turn Directions: Find the quickest route from one place to another without the need of a GPS or data service. Simply enter an exhibitor name or room nearest to you and where you want to go, and the app will provide directions.
My Schedule: Create a schedule to keep track of the events you wish to attend.
New Products Showcase: View all of the products entered into the New Products Showcase, complete with detailed information and photos, exactly where within the Showcase the product is displayed, and directions to the exhibitor's booth on the Show floor.
Product Scanner: Use your smartphone as a scanner at the New Products Showcase to create a list and map of the scanned products.
Maps: View floorplans of all SEMA Show halls and how/where they connect to make passage from hall to hall as easy as possible.
Exhibitors: Look up all SEMA Show exhibitors by name, Show section or product category.
Events, Celebrity Appearances and Speakers:See lists of all the events, seminars, conferences, celebrity appearances and speakers, including day, time and location.
Social Media: Keep up with the feeds of the official SEMA Show social media accounts, including Instagram, Facebook, Twitter and YouTube.
Ground Transportation: Find the best way to arrive at the Las Vegas Convention Center. Obtain information on the Las Vegas Monorail, rideshare and hotel shuttles, including pickup locations.
